The Global Pharmaceutical Cleaning Validation Market is valued at approximately USD 6.46 billion in 2023 and is projected to register a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 12.03% during the forecast period 2024 to 2032. Cleaning validation, a cornerstone of Good Manufacturing Practice (GMP), has become indispensable in modern pharmaceutical manufacturing due to its critical role in ensuring product safety, efficacy, and regulatory compliance. As cross-contamination concerns intensify with the surge in complex multi-product facilities, companies are proactively adopting stringent validation protocols. These frameworks span across cleaning methods, equipment qualification, analytical technique verification, and the integration of computerized systems that document, store, and secure data trails. The ongoing transformation of pharma production from batch-based systems to more agile, continuous processes further amplifies the relevance of cleaning validation as a strategic enabler of compliance and operational excellence.

The surging investment in biologics, personalized medicine, and highly potent drug compounds has accelerated the implementation of cutting-edge cleaning validation technologies. Companies are shifting from manual recordkeeping to automated, software-driven validation platforms that adhere to global standards like FDA 21 CFR Part 11 and EMA Annex 15. Simultaneously, the increasing focus on sustainable manufacturing is giving rise to innovations in Clean-in-Place (CIP), Steam-in-Place (SIP), and ultrasonic cleaning systems that reduce water and solvent usage while delivering reproducible results. These trends are not only streamlining facility turnaround times but are also helping manufacturers avoid regulatory pitfalls that could result in costly recalls or reputational damage. However, despite these benefits, barriers such as the high cost of validation system implementation and complexity in multi-site standardization still present significant challenges for market players.

As pharmaceutical supply chains expand globally, maintaining harmonized compliance across diverse geographic markets has become a core challenge. Each region enforces its own validation expectations rooted in local interpretations of GMP, requiring manufacturers to demonstrate flexibility and nuanced understanding of region-specific frameworks like ICH Q7 or ISO 14644. The validation burden is particularly high in contract manufacturing and CDMO environments, where client-specific cleaning protocols must be precisely documented and verifiable. Nonetheless, the widespread digital transformation in life sciences is fostering the rise of real-time monitoring solutions and AI-driven cleaning cycle optimization, empowering organizations to cut down validation cycle time and shift toward a predictive compliance model. These technological pivots are redefining the scope of validation not as a regulatory burden but as a continuous quality assurance tool.

With pharma and biotech firms striving to scale their operations globally, strategic collaborations, M&A activity, and investment in digital infrastructure are becoming vital levers for competitive advantage. Regulatory agencies worldwide are increasingly promoting data integrity and traceability, compelling companies to re-evaluate legacy systems in favor of cloud-based validation suites that integrate seamlessly with enterprise manufacturing execution systems (MES). Furthermore, the expansion of high-throughput drug production, particularly in oncology and vaccine sectors, is creating parallel demand for robust, error-proof cleaning protocols that can ensure sterility and traceability across large-scale batches. As a result, stakeholders are making considerable capital outlays in automation and compliance technology to mitigate operational risks while enhancing speed-to-market.

Regionally, North America held the dominant share of the Pharmaceutical Cleaning Validation Market in 2023, primarily due to stringent FDA regulations, a mature pharmaceutical ecosystem, and a high concentration of biomanufacturing facilities. Europe follows closely, with the region demonstrating a strong adherence to EMA guidelines and growing emphasis on GMP certification in the life sciences sector. Asia Pacific, however, is forecasted to witness the most rapid growth, fueled by the region’s expanding pharmaceutical export capabilities, increasing government mandates for local manufacturing compliance, and a growing biotech startup ecosystem in countries like India, China, and South Korea. These trends indicate a paradigm shift toward harmonized validation practices as pharmaceutical quality assurance becomes a global imperative.
